Vacuum Circuit Breaker (VCB)\r\n TheVacuum Circuit Breaker (VCB) is a crucial device used in electrical power systems to protect circuits from overloads, short circuits, and other electrical faults. It operates by automatically disconnecting power when abnormal conditions are detected, preventing damage to electrical equipment. The VCB utilizes a vacuum environment to extinguish the arc that forms when the breaker opens. This vacuum arc quenching provides superior insulation, minimizes wear, and enhances the breaker\u2019s longevity and reliability compared to traditional breakers.\r\n VCBs are widely employed in medium-voltage electrical systems, such as substations, industrial plants, and power distribution networks. Their compact size, low maintenance needs, and high breaking capacity make them a preferred choice for modern electrical grids. With advancements in technology, VCBs are essential in maintaining the safety and efficiency of electrical systems, contributing to a more reliable and eco-friendly power distribution infrastructure.\r\n TheVacuum Circuit Breaker offers several advantages over other types of circuit breakers, particularly in medium-voltage applications. It is known for its high interrupting capacity and ability to perform well in high-fault current conditions. Additionally, its environmentally friendly design, which eliminates the use of oil or gas for arc quenching, makes it a sustainable choice for modern electrical networks. By employing VCBs, industries can reduce maintenance costs, enhance system stability, and minimize the environmental impact of electrical fault protection devices.","link":"https:\/\/pineele.com\/high-voltage-components\/vacuum-circuit-breaker","name":"Vacuum Circuit Breaker","slug":"vacuum-circuit-breaker","taxonomy":"category","parent":27,"meta":[],"acf":[],"yoast_head":"\n
